Crème Brûlée Banana Cheesecake

A decadent fusion of creamy cheesecake, ripe bananas, and a caramelized sugar topping.

Ingredients

Scale

For the Crust:

  • 2 cups graham cracker crumbs
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 24 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ar (for topping)

Instructions

1. Prepare the Crust:

  1. Preheat oven to 325°F (165°C). Mix graham cracker crumbs with melted butter and press into a 9-inch springform pan.
  2. In a large bowl, beat cream cheese and sugar until smooth. Add eggs one at a time, then mix in vanilla and sour cream.
  3. Fold in mashed bananas, then pour mixture over the crust. Bake for 45-50 minutes until set but slightly jiggly in the center.
  4. Cool completely, then refrigerate for at least 4 hours. Before serving, sprinkle brown sugar evenly over the top and caramelize with a kitchen torch.
  5. Let sugar harden for 2 minutes before slicing.
